Arrange the following metals in the order in which they displace each other from the solution of their salts. `Al, Cu, Fe, Mg, ` and `Zn`.

Text Solution

AI Generated Solution

To arrange the metals Al, Cu, Fe, Mg, and Zn in the order of their ability to displace each other from the solutions of their salts, we need to consider their reactivity. The more reactive a metal is, the more readily it will displace a less reactive metal from its salt solution. ### Step-by-Step Solution: 1. **Understand Reactivity Series**: The reactivity series is a list of metals arranged in order of decreasing reactivity.
